#21You should increase your unit size varying with your BR initial investment was 100-500-1000-2500 and so on.
Your at 850. 500 = 1 Unit = $7.50 do not bet more than 3 units, 1-3 unit range. 2 unit standard play you should be betting $15.00 per game.
Withdraw only if you get limited, or you need the money...once you increased your roll to a certain size you will know when to withdraw it depends...$500 won't matter to you...$2500 might. Get it up to around $2000-$5000 mark then talk withdrawal.
Be aggressive with your progress but apply some protection with your sampling size. Increase your unit stake when you do well but decrease your quantity of betting range, bet smart...smart odds pick your spots don't bet too many games..

#32Setup a coinbase accountOriginally posted by gregmav1i kind of agree with you. im just trying to find out how to cash out. i have 0 experience with bitcoin, with **, anything like that. and their site is pretty vague when it comes to payouts and not very helpful.
Setup a blockchain account
How on to 5dimes chat, tell them you want a bitcoin payout, log onto your blockchain acct and get the wallet address and send to 5dimes when they ask where to send it. when you receive it in the next 48 hours, send it from your blockchain to your coinbase acct, then you can sell it and it will credit your bank account.
No need to get in car, no need to deal with bank, no hassles.Comment -
